Road rage. It seems like such a childish response. Until someone cuts us off or pulls in front of us or slows us down because they are texting. Then, it's our responsibility to let him/her know of their wrongdoing. When it comes to us, it's not road rage - it's helping others know how to drive. It's often no different in our relationships. When we are hurt, we feel the need to get even. Then s/he feels the need to get even with us. Pretty soon, we're locked in a cesspool of hatred and revenge. Scripture gives us some examples of how hatred and revenge can eventually lead to death. But forgiveness, a recurring theme throughout the scriptures, is a pathway to freedom. There is a flow to forgiveness—from God, to us, to others. In the next couple of weeks, we're going to explore the pain and destruction found in revenge and the freedom that flows out of forgiveness.
